Embarking on the journey of data migration is a critical step in organizational evolution, but its success hinges upon meticulous planning and execution. In the realm of data migration, a robust test plan serves as the compass, guiding businesses through the complex terrain of transferring crucial information seamlessly. “Unlocking Success With A Solid Data Migration Test Plan” delves into the strategic importance of a well-structured test plan, unraveling the key elements that ensure a smooth transition.
From mitigating risks to validating data integrity, this exploration navigates the pivotal role a comprehensive test plan plays in unlocking the full potential of data migration endeavors. Join us in unraveling the intricacies of this indispensable roadmap to success in the dynamic landscape of data migration.
Contents
- 1 Understanding the Importance of Data Migration Testing
- 2 Developing a Comprehensive Data Migration Test Strategy
- 3 Implementing Pre and Post-Migration Testing
- 4 Effective Testing Tools and Environments for Data Migration
- 5 Establishing a Robust Data Migration Test Plan
- 6 Frequently Asked Questions [FAQs]
- 6.1 Q: What is a data migration test plan?
- 6.2 Q: Why is a migration testing checklist important in data migration?
- 6.3 Q: What are the key components of a data migration test plan?
- 6.4 Q: How can real data be used in data migration testing?
- 6.5 Q: What are the phases of migration in a data migration test plan?
- 6.6 Q: What is the significance of conducting post-migration testing?
- 6.7 Q: What are some common challenges in migration testing?
- 6.8 Q: How can data integrity be verified after migration?
- 6.9 Q: What precautions should be taken to prevent data loss during migration?
- 6.10 Q: What role does the migration test specification play in data migration?
- 7 Conclusion
Understanding the Importance of Data Migration Testing
Data migration testing is a critical process in the successful transfer of data from one system to another. It involves testing the migration process to ensure that data is migrated accurately and without loss. Successful data migration testing requires careful planning and execution to mitigate potential risks associated with data migration. Without effective data migration testing, businesses may face challenges such as data loss, poor data quality, and disruption to business operations.
Challenges in data migration testing can arise from various factors, such as the volume of data being migrated, the complexity of the data types, and the integrity of the source data. Additionally, the actual migration process itself can pose challenges, including potential data loss, maintaining data integrity, and ensuring a smooth migration without disruptions to business operations.
On the other hand, an effective data migration testing strategy offers several benefits. It provides confidence in the accuracy and completeness of the migrated data, ensures data quality in the new system, minimizes the risk of data loss, and facilitates a smooth transition to the new system.
Developing a Comprehensive Data Migration Test Strategy
A comprehensive data migration test strategy encompasses key components to ensure the success of the migration process. This includes defining clear objectives for the testing process, identifying the scope of the migration, analyzing the impact on current data systems, and establishing risk mitigation strategies.
Creating a data migration testing checklist is essential in developing a comprehensive test strategy. The checklist should detail the specific tests to be conducted, the expected outcomes, and the criteria for success. It ensures that all aspects of the migration process are thoroughly evaluated and tested.
Ensuring data quality in the migration process is crucial for the integrity of the migrated data. A data migration test strategy should include measures to validate the accuracy, completeness, and consistency of the data being migrated. This involves identifying and resolving any issues related to poor data quality prior to the migration.
Implementing Pre and Post-Migration Testing
Pre-migration testing plays a vital role in identifying any potential issues or obstacles that may arise during the actual migration. It allows the testing team to evaluate the readiness of the systems and data for migration, address any identified issues, and minimize the risk of disruptions to the migration process.
Post-migration testing best practices involve conducting thorough tests after the migration to ensure that the data has been accurately transferred and that the new system functions as expected. This includes verifying data integrity, performing validation checks, and confirming that the migrated data meets the specified requirements.
Evaluating the success of data migration is essential to determine whether the migration process has achieved its objectives. This involves assessing the accuracy and completeness of the migrated data, addressing any issues that may have arisen during the migration, and ensuring that the new system operates effectively with the migrated data.
Effective Testing Tools and Environments for Data Migration
Selecting the right testing tool for data migration is crucial for conducting thorough and efficient testing. The chosen testing tool should provide the necessary capabilities to perform both black-box and white-box testing to validate the migration process and ensure the integrity of the migrated data.
Optimizing the test environment for successful data migration involves creating an environment that closely mirrors the production environment. This ensures that the testing accurately simulates the actual migration process and identifies any potential issues that may arise during the migration to ensure a successful transition.
Assessing data integrity during the migration process is essential to identify any discrepancies or inconsistencies in the migrated data. It involves comparing the source data with the migrated data to ensure that the migration process has preserved the integrity and accuracy of the data.
Establishing a Robust Data Migration Test Plan
Defining comprehensive test cases for data migration is fundamental to verifying the accurate transfer of data from the legacy system to the new system. Test cases should cover various scenarios, data types, and potential challenges to ensure a thorough evaluation of the migration process.
Managing potential data loss during migration involves implementing strategies to mitigate the risk of data loss and ensure the completeness and accuracy of the migrated data. This includes data backup measures, validation checks, and contingency plans to address any potential data loss scenarios.
Building a solid test approach for a successful migration requires careful planning, meticulous execution, and attention to detail. This involves engaging the migration team, defining clear roles and responsibilities, and establishing effective communication channels to ensure a coordinated effort in achieving a successful migration.
Frequently Asked Questions [FAQs]
Q: What is a data migration test plan?
A data migration test plan is a comprehensive strategy that outlines the approach, objectives, and activities for testing the migration of data from one system to another.
Q: Why is a migration testing checklist important in data migration?
A migration testing checklist is essential in data migration to ensure that all necessary tests are performed, data integrity is maintained, and the migration process is successful.
Q: What are the key components of a data migration test plan?
The key components of a data migration test plan include test environment setup, test process definition, pre-migration testing, effective data migration testing, and validation of the migrated data.
Q: How can real data be used in data migration testing?
Real data can be utilized in data migration testing to simulate actual scenarios, identify potential issues, and ensure the accuracy and completeness of the migrated data.
Q: What are the phases of migration in a data migration test plan?
The phases of migration in a data migration test plan typically include planning, analysis, design, execution, and validation of the data migration process.
Q: What is the significance of conducting post-migration testing?
Post-migration testing is essential to verify the integrity and functionality of the migrated data, identify any potential issues, and ensure a smooth transition to the new system.
Q: What are some common challenges in migration testing?
Common challenges in migration testing include handling a large volume of data, mitigating the risk of data loss, ensuring the accuracy of the migration process, and addressing compatibility issues.
Q: How can data integrity be verified after migration?
Data integrity can be verified after migration through the validation of test cases and test scenarios, ensuring that the data in the new system matches the original data and that no loss or corruption has occurred.
Q: What precautions should be taken to prevent data loss during migration?
To prevent data loss during migration, it is important to perform a backup of the data, conduct thorough testing, use reliable migration tools, and implement effective risk mitigation strategies.
Q: What role does the migration test specification play in data migration?
The migration test specification outlines the specific tests, scenarios, and criteria for validating the migration process, ensuring that all aspects of the data migration are thoroughly tested and verified.
Conclusion
In the world of data management, a solid data migration test plan is your roadmap to success. It can be the difference between a smooth transition and costly, time-consuming setbacks. But with the right strategy and preparation, you can navigate the complexity of data migration and ensure the integrity and security of your data.
Remember, it’s not just about moving data from Point A to Point B; it’s about ensuring that data is usable, accessible, and reliable at its new destination. So, get started today and unlock your pathway to successful data migration. Don’t you want to unlock success with a solid data migration test plan?